DESCRIPTION OF WORK
As a Safety Inspector, you will be responsible for maintaining and inspecting all fire safety equipment within the department’s managed and/or owned buildings. This position requires a thorough knowledge and understanding of the laws, regulations, and procedures pertaining to asbestos, lead based paint, various other hazardous containing materials, fire prevention, life safety, safety programs, and associated training. Work involves reviewing building plans, conducting annual asbestos inspections, collecting environmental hazardous material samples, and conducting quarterly reviews of evacuation teams. You will have the opportunity to assist with building evacuations, respond to emergency fire alarm activations, as well as respond to complaints of odors or airborne irritants. Additional responsibilities include:
+ Completing partition modifications of inner office walls to ensure fire safety codes are followed
+ Investigating fire alarm system issues
+ Troubleshooting fire alarms and sprinkler systems
+ Completing monthly and annual inspections of all fire extinguishers
+ Assisting with fire extinguisher training
+ Compiling activity reports
+ Conducting workman’s compensation accident investigations

REQUIRED EXPERIENCE, TRAINING & ELIGIBILITY
QUALIFICATIONS
Minimum Experience and Training Requirements:
+ Successful completion of the Safety Inspector Trainee program (Commonwealth job title or equivalent Federal Government job title, as determined by the Office of Administration);or
+ One year of experience inspecting commercial, industrial, healthcare or other buildings or structures, machines, apparatus, devices or equipment for compliance with applicable safety codes and regulations;or
+ An equivalent combination of experience and training.
Conditions of Employment:
+ You must possess a valid Pennsylvania driver’s license.
Post Employment Requirement:
+ You must obtain a valid certification in 40-Hour HAZWOPER License or HazMat Operations level certificate from an accredited organization within the first year of employment.
+ You must obtain a valid certification issued by the Pennsylvania Department of Labor and Industry as an Asbestos Supervisor/Contractor License within the first year of employment.
+ You must obtain a Certificate for Confined Space Entrant, Attendant and Supervisor Training within first year of employment.
